When Amazon workers were negotiating for a Union, a reporter wondered if at least half of Americans support them forming a union.
a) What should be the null and alternative hypotheses to test the reporters claim?
b) Describe type I and type II errors in the context of the problem.
c) A union official decides they will conduct a simulation based on a small sample size.
Below are the simulation results based on many, many simulated samples.
If at least 15 people in the simulated sample of 20 people support them forming a union, they will reject the null hypothesis.
Using the simulation results provided, estimate the probability of committing a type I error. Using the values in the table, explain how you determined the probability.
Suppose the true proportion of those in the population that support Amazon workers forming a union is 80%. Use the simulation results provided to estimate the probability of committing a type II error. Using the values in the table, explain how you determined the probability.
